Son of William NEALE and Sarah TOWNSEND (they both arrived in 1794 on the convict transport "Surprize" but were not formally married until 1810), and brother of William James NEALE (born at Parramatta, 20 November 1799), Sarah Matilda NEALE (born 1801; married William PIPER), George Roddle NEALE (born 1804), and Mary Ann NEALE (born 1811).
John was at Liverpool, 1817, 1823-24; Overseer to Captain BROOK at Denham Court, Lower Minto, 1827; Farmer at Mountpleasant, County Murray, 1832-33; Butcher in Sydney, 1840-43; at Berrima, 1855-59; later lived at Macquarie Street, Parramatta, where he died.
John was married firstly, in 1816, to Sarah NICKELSON or NICHOLSON; she died at Berrima in 1829.
John, of Berrimah, was married secondly, at Redfern, to Anna Maria WILLIAMS, widow of the late Octavius John BREDAN of London; she died at Macquarie Street, Parramatta, on 14 January 1863, aged 46.
John and Sarah had issue:
1. Elizabeth NEALE, born Liverpool, 1817; died 18 April 1855; married firstly, Roger STEERE, with issue one daughter; Elizabeth married secondly, John PARKER, with further issue.

10. Nathaniel NEALE, born Sydney, 1840; Customs Locker in Sydney; died 1886; he married firstly, Esther SPENCE (sister of Elizabeth SPENCE, the wife of Rev James ADAM of Carcoar & Blayney); he married secondly, Mary SINCLAIR.
